Margaret Swift Thompson brings another heartfelt episode of The Embrace Family Recovery Podcast, featuring Patrick Flanagan, a recovering alcoholic with a mission to heal families affected by addiction. Patrick shares his journey, emphasising the importance of family involvement in recovery. He talks about launching the Lion House Brownstone Women's Recovery Residence, where family recovery coaching is a key component.
Patrick's dedication to maintaining his AA program and community involvement shines through as he reflects on his own experiences and the ongoing support he receives from his family, particularly his daughter Josie. The episode dives into the challenges and triumphs of recovery, highlighting how structured, family-centered programs can make a significant difference. Patrick's story is a testament to the power of community and the importance of service work in maintaining sobriety.
